signed short,也写作signed short int(简写为short) signed(表示signed int) 浮点型: signed float(简写为float) signed double(简写为double) 字符型: signed char(简写为char) 无符号数: 整形:整形有无符号数,用来表示一些编码编号之类的东西。譬如身份证号,房间号 unsigned int(没有简写) unsigned long int(...
(1)单精度浮点型(float) 单精度浮点型的大小是 4 字节 float v1 = 4.345; unsigned float v1 = 4.345; 无符号的 float 数据 格式匹配符是:%f , 默认保留 6 位小数。 (2)双精度浮点型(double) 双精度浮点型的大小为 8 字节 double v2 = 5.678; unsigned double v2 = 5...
实型类型 实型变量又可分为单精度(float)、双精度(double)和长双精度(longdouble)3种,这里我们就看float和double这两种。 类型 比特数 有效数字 取值范围float326~7−3.4×10−38~3.4×1038double6415~16−1.7×10−308~1.7×10308longdouble6418~19−1.2×10−308~1.2×10308 要注意的是,这里...
在C#中,数据类型由关键字“ Double ”表示。下面是此数据类型的示例。同样的double和大写开头的Double是一样的。 在我们的示例中,我们将定义一个名为x的双精度变量。然后,我们将给变量分配一个Double值,然后相应地显示它。 代码说明: 1.指定double数据类型以声明一个称为x的double类型变量。然后为变量分配3.1415926...
一个double类型占用8个字节的存储位。 最高位为符号位,紧接着8位为指数位,剩下的52位为尾数位。 格式说明符:%lf 3、字符型char(1字节) 字符型在其本质上就是整形,我们在C语言中使用char表示一个字符型,他占用一个字符的存储空间,字符型在存储时其内部存储的依旧是二进制数据,当我们读出时将会得到一个整形...
sizeof() 是一个获取数据类型或者表达式长度的运算符。例如:sizeof(int)就是获取int型的长度,所以值为4,即int型占4字节内存。double是C语言的一个关键字,代表双精度浮点型。占8 个字节(64位)内存空间。其数值范围为1.7E-308~1.7E+308,双精度完全保证的有效数字是15位,16位只是部分数值...
3.14L:长双精度浮点型 long double 'a':字符型 char "abcd":字符指针 char * inta=100;// a是变量,而100是常量floatf=3.14;// f是变量,而3.14是常量chars[]="abcd";//s是变量,"abcd"是常量 变量 在程序运行过程中其值可以改变的量。 本质:变量代表内存中具有特定属性的存储单元,变量名实际是符号化...
long double dip = 5.32e-5; printf("%f can be written %e\n", aboat, aboat); // 下一行要求编译器支持C99或其中的相关特性 printf("And it's %a in hexadecimal, powers of 2 notation\n", aboat); printf("%f can be written %e\n", abet, abet); ...
long double: 12 byte = 96 bit范围: 1.18973e+4932 ~ 3.3621e-4932 float: 4 byte = 32 bit范围: 3.40282e+038 ~ 1.17549e-038 int、unsigned、long、unsigned long 、double的数量级最大都仅仅能表示为10亿,即它们表示十进制的位数不超过10个,即能够保存全部9位整数。而short仅仅是能表示5位; ...